MySQL修改一个字段的注释脚本方案

问题背景

在开发过程中,数据库表的设计是一个非常重要的环节。在创建表的时候,我们通常会为每个字段添加注释,以便于其他开发人员或维护人员能够更好地理解字段的含义。但是有时候,我们可能需要修改字段的注释,例如字段的含义发生了变化或者需要更详细的描述。那么如何通过脚本来修改一个字段的注释呢?本文将给出一个解决方案。

方案概述

我们可以通过ALTER TABLE语句来修改一个字段的注释。ALTER TABLE语句是MySQL用于更改表定义的命令,通过该命令我们可以添加、修改或删除表的列、索引、约束等。

具体来说,我们需要执行以下步骤:

  1. 首先,连接到MySQL数据库,并选择需要修改字段注释的数据库。
  2. 然后,使用DESCRIBE语句查看表的结构,找到需要修改注释的字段名。
  3. 使用ALTER TABLE语句修改字段的注释。

代码示例

下面是一个代码示例,演示了如何通过脚本来修改一个字段的注释。

-- 连接到MySQL数据库
mysql -u username -p password

-- 选择需要修改字段注释的数据库
USE database_name;

-- 查看表的结构
DESCRIBE table_name;

-- 修改字段的注释
ALTER TABLE table_name MODIFY COLUMN column_name column_type COMMENT 'new_comment';
  • username是MySQL数据库的用户名;
  • password是MySQL数据库的密码;
  • database_name是需要修改字段注释的数据库名;
  • table_name是需要修改字段注释的表名;
  • column_name是需要修改注释的字段名;
  • column_type是字段的数据类型;
  • new_comment是新的注释。

流程图

下面是一个使用Mermaid语法绘制的流程图,描述了修改字段注释的步骤。

journey
    title 修改字段注释流程
    section 连接数据库
        开始 --> 连接数据库
        连接数据库 --> 选择数据库
    section 查看表结构
        选择数据库 --> 查看表结构
    section 修改字段注释
        查看表结构 --> 修改字段注释
        修改字段注释 --> 结束
    结束 --> 开始

关系图

下面是一个使用Mermaid语法绘制的关系图,描述了字段注释的修改关系。

erDiagram
    table 表名 {
        字段名 -- 注释
    }

总结

通过本文所述的方案,我们可以通过脚本来修改一个字段的注释。这样可以提高开发效率,减少人工操作的错误,同时也便于文档的维护和更新。希望本文对你有所帮助!